Pumpkin Rice

Pumpkin Rice is a comforting Korean vegetarian dish that combines sweet, creamy pumpkin with fluffy rice, creating a delightful harmony of flavors and textures. This vibrant dish is not only visually appealing but also packed with nutrients, making it a perfect meal for any occasion.

Ingredients

  • Short-grain rice - 1 cup (200g)
  • Pumpkin, peeled and cubed - 200g
  • Water - 2 cups (500ml)
  • Soy sauce - 1 tablespoon (15ml)
  • Sesame oil - 1 tablespoon (15ml)
  • Garlic, minced - 2 cloves
  • Green onion, chopped - 2 stalks
  • Salt - to taste
  • Black pepper - to taste
  • Sesame seeds - 1 teaspoon (optional) for garnish

Steps

  1. Rinse the short-grain rice under cold water until the water runs clear, then soak it in water for 30 minutes.
  2. While the rice is soaking, steam or boil the pumpkin cubes until they are tender, about 10-15 minutes. Drain and set aside.
  3. In a pot, combine the soaked rice and 2 cups of water. Bring to a boil, then reduce the heat to low, cover, and simmer for about 15-20 minutes until the rice is cooked and the water is absorbed.
  4. In a large mixing bowl, combine the cooked rice, steamed pumpkin, minced garlic, soy sauce, sesame oil, salt, and pepper. Mix until well combined and the pumpkin is slightly mashed into the rice.
  5. Serve the pumpkin rice warm, garnished with chopped green onions and sesame seeds if desired.
